DRIVING TIPS DINGHY TOWING TRAILER TOWING Your vehicle is designed primarily as a passenger−carrying vehicle. Towing a trailer will have an adverse effect on handling, performance, braking, durability and driving economy (fuel consumption etc.). Your safety and satisfaction depend on the proper use of correct equipment and cautious driving habits. For your safety and the safety of others, you must not overload your vehicle or trailer. Lexus warranties do not apply to damage or malfunction caused by towing a trailer for commercial purposes. Ask your local Lexus dealer for further details before towing. We recommend you to use a weight carrying hitch when towing a trailer. Your vehicle is not designed to be dinghy towed (with four wheels on the ground) behind a motorhome. NOTICE NOTICE Do not tow your vehicle with four wheels on the ground. This may cause serious damage to your vehicle. When towing a trailer, be sure to consult your Lexus dealer for further information on additional requirements such as a towing kit etc. 284
